1291.0. "OA$SITE_CMSLIB Logical...?" by JULIET::SELLECK_AL () Fri Aug 21 1992 20:26

    I just added CMS so that my customer could use the Merge Base 
    Element (MBE) option. Right off we got an error that said
    that no CMS Library was found in OA$SITE_CMSLIB directory.
    I created the Library and put it into a Directory called:
    
    	[ALLIN1.SITE.CMSLIB] 
    
    I then manually created the OA$SITE_CMSLIB logical, and pointed
    it to the above directory....My question is:
    
    	Where does the logical OA$SITE_CMSLIB get defined?
    
    	Is there any documentation on setting up CMS so the 
    	MBE option will work correctly? (I'm sure there is, and
    	I just don't have a full documentation set)

1291.1Not documented in v3.0AIMTEC::WICKS_AIt wasn't supposed to end this wayFri Aug 21 1992 22:5313
    Mike,
    
    Having the documentation handy wouldn't have helped you since it isn't
    documented. Searching the old field test conference which is where I
    found out how to do it suggests you put:
    
    $define/system/executive oa$site_cmslib sys$sysdevice:[allin1.site.cms]
    
    in A1V30_SITE_START.COM
